Jessica uses a non-judgmental, social justice and relational approach to assist clients in navigating relationships, life transitions, mental illness and healing from past hurts.
Jessica Studer is a licensed clinical social worker who earned her MSW at Smith College School for Social Work. She is trained in psychodynamic, EMDR (Eye Movement Desensitation Reprocessing) and IFS-informed (Internal Family Systems) approaches. She has over a decade or experience in the mental health field working with a variety of issues including anxiety, depression, PTSD, complex trauma, bipolar disorder, ADHD and life transitions. Her passion and expertise is helping people better understand how they are in relationship with others, healing from past traumas and navigating unjust systems.
